1978 Opel Rekord vs. 1995 ZAZ Slavuta
To start off, 1995 ZAZ Slavuta is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1978 Opel Rekord.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1978 Opel Rekord would be higher. At 1,688 cc (4 cylinders), 1978 Opel Rekord is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1978 Opel Rekord weights approximately 355 kg more than 1995 ZAZ Slavuta.
Because 1978 Opel Rekord is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1978 Opel Rekord.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1995 ZAZ Slavuta,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. Compare all specifications:
1978 Opel Rekord | 1995 ZAZ Slavuta | |
Make | Opel | ZAZ |
Model | Rekord | Slavuta |
Year Released | 1978 | 1995 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1688 cc | 1091 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 51 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 1100 kg | 745 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4630 mm | 3990 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1740 mm | 1590 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1480 mm | 1440 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2680 mm | 2330 mm |
